Is marketing your ONE Thing? Does it make everything else you do easier or unnecessary? For some of you, the answer is “Yes.” But, for many of you, the answer is “No,” and yet, marketing is still a vital priority of your business. It brings the revenue which drives the profit which funds the mission. As you go on this marketing journey – and whether you’re a professional or not – there are a lot of challenges to avoid falling into. Thankfully, there are a lot of resources available to learn and help you master the vital skill of marketing. One of those is Scott Miller’s book, “Marketing Mess to Brand Success,” and Scott joins us, this week, to explore how he’s disrupted his life over the past few months and increased his overall happiness. He shows us how to overcome the challenges of marketing and growing businesses. Whether you are a marketing professional or have to wear that hat in your business, you can start to identify some of the challenges that you are falling trap to and learn to overcome them.
